Far West and Orana · Region (SA4)
How far people went at school, the qualifications they hold and what they studied.
Fewer residents in Far West and Orana have completed high school or university compared to other parts of the country. Only 37.1% of people finished Year 12, which is far below the national figure. While schooling and degree rates have risen since 2011, the region still faces significant educational gaps.
Highest year of school completed.
Year 12 completion is far below the New South Wales and national figures, though it rose 7.2 percentage points since 2011 to reach 37.1%. Many residents stopped after Year 10, with 28.8% listing that as their highest year of school.

Post-school qualifications and degrees.
Adults with a bachelor degree or higher make up 13.5% of the population, which is far below the New South Wales rate of 27.8%. The most common qualification is a Certificate III or IV, held by 32.7% of people.

What people studied.
The most common fields of study for those with qualifications are management and commerce at 13.8%, followed by engineering and related fields at 13.1%. Health and society and culture are also frequent choices.
Schools in the area and how many children they serve (ACARA).
There are 109 schools serving 18,608 students, which is among the highest number of schools per 1,000 children in similar areas. These schools tend to be small, with an average size of 174 students and an average advantage score among the lowest at this level.
